30, The Haven, Cambridge is recorded publicly as a modern freehold house across 1,442 ft2 of internal area, sitting on a 418 m2 plot.
Locally, houses of this size normally have 4 bedrooms with a garden.
Our estimate of the sale value of 30, The Haven, Cambridge is £661,029 and its rental estimate is £1,853 per month, given the available information and assuming reasonable condition.
The Haven, Fulbourn, Cambridge, CB21 falls within the CB21 postal district, in the borough of South Cambridgeshire.
30, The Haven, Cambridge has 21 entries in the Land Registry , most recently in October 2019 and a single entry in the EPC database dated April 2018.

HM Land Registry records the plot of land for 30, The Haven, Cambridge as measuring 418 m2.
That makes it the 8th largest plot in the postcode, where 32 of the 34 other houses have recorded plot data.
30, The Haven, Cambridge has an Energy Performance Rating (EPC) of D. This is based on the most recent assessment, dated 24 Apr 2018.
The property is connected to mains gas and has fully double glazed windows. It is heated using Boiler and radiators, mains gas.
The most recent sale of 30, The Haven, Cambridge completed on 7th October 2019 at £578,000 and was recorded by HM Land Registry as a freehold house.
Since 1995 the property has sold twice.
